" Whiteline Black Box

Like many other modern vehicles, the 2003-2006 G3350Z is equipped with an electronic stability control system; Nissan has two systems depending on what trim level your 03-06 is. The Enthusiast Z/G has Traction Control System (TCS), while the Track 350Z is equipped with Vehicle Dynamic Control (VDC). Both systems achieve similar results but do so in different ways. TCS reduces engine speed (throttle cut) when the computer detects that a wheel is spinning at a disproportionate amount to the speed your Z is traveling.

VDC uses throttle cut and additionally limits the amount of wheel spin allowed by using a Brake Limited Slip Differential (LSD) based on data from a Yaw sensor. The Brake LSD system goes into action when one of the drive wheels is spinning on a slippery surface by braking the spinning wheel to redistribute power to the other, non-slipping drive wheel.

While Nissan is nice enough to give you an "off" button for both of these systems, they never are fully disabled. Whiteline's Black Box solves this problem by allowing you to electronically tune your Nissan 350Z's TCS/VDC to give control of the amount of wheel spin. The patented Black Box system is unique in allowing cockpit adjustable handling bias, a single dial delivers more oversteer or understeer on demand. Only Whiteline's Black Box lets you tune the amount of TCS/VDC intervention and even turn off stability control completely, without error codes or warning lights.
